1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a system of equations?

Back

A system of equations is a set of two or more equations with the same variables. The solution is the point(s) where the equations intersect.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you represent a word problem as an equation?

Back

Identify the variables, translate the problem into mathematical expressions, and set up an equation based on the relationships described.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does it mean to solve a system of equations?

Back

To find the values of the variables that satisfy all equations in the system simultaneously.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a linear equation?

Back

A linear equation is an equation that makes a straight line when graphed. It has the form y = mx + b, where m is the slope and b is the y-intercept.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you find the intersection of two lines?

Back

Set the equations equal to each other and solve for the variable. The solution gives the coordinates of the intersection point.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a variable in mathematics?

Back

A variable is a symbol used to represent an unknown value in mathematical expressions or equations.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the purpose of using a setup fee in a word problem?

Back

A setup fee is a fixed cost that must be added to the total cost, regardless of the number of items purchased.
